Chapter 154 - Chapter 153: Whoa, Wait for Me!

The commotion had come from inside the house—followed by a deafening explosion.

Goodwin prided himself on the quality control of all the electronic devices in his home. He had no habit of keeping outdated junk around either.

Even the oldest appliance wouldn't just spontaneously explode—that was absurd.

Which left only one possibility: he had an "uninvited guest."

The enemy was in the shadows while he was in the open. Staring at the tightly shut bedroom door, Goodwin didn't rush out immediately. In such a short time, he couldn't figure out why anyone would choose this moment to infiltrate his home.

A corporate rival? A personal enemy? Or just some petty thief?

The home security system hadn't been triggered. The automated turrets outside hadn't reacted either… Did the intruder have a netrunner backing them up?

After a long moment of thought, Goodwin's face darkened as he tried dialing out.

But the call got no response at all. The outgoing signal vanished like a stone sinking into the sea.

It seemed these intruders were using a comms jammer.

Still standing in place, Goodwin glanced at the blonde woman lying on the bed. The poor thing looked utterly confused, clearly having no idea what was happening.

Obviously, this wasn't her doing.

Which meant the other side had gone through all this trouble for one reason—their target was him.

As a senior executive of Moore Technologies, Goodwin would never keep any important company secrets at home. All valuable research data was stored in the company's secure database.

No halfway competent employee would keep critical files at home either.

If someone was stupid enough to do so and the company found out—especially if it caused losses—they'd better learn how to "commit suicide by shooting themselves in the back a dozen times."

Goodwin scanned the room. No handy weapons, no firearms. Naturally, he wouldn't keep heavy ordnance in such a private space.

After one last glance at the blonde woman, he picked up a stool and smashed it into the surveillance camera in the room, destroying it.

Then he grabbed a syringe of anesthetic and, without hesitation, injected it into the woman's arm.

The blonde felt a wave of exhaustion wash over her. Her body was already weak, and now she could no longer fight the pull of sleep. Her eyelids closed, and she sank into unconsciousness.

The bedroom door burst open, and a figure stepped inside.

Kitagawa Hiroshi scanned the room, frowning.

The middle-aged man was nowhere to be seen.

"Sasha, what the hell? Where'd he go?"

"I don't know," Sasha replied, worry in her voice. "He smashed the only camera in the room, then the feed went dark. I've still got access to the other cameras in the house, but there's no sign of him."

"And I suggest you get out of there, fast. That blast earlier definitely drew the building's security's attention. You won't have much time before they lock the place down."

"I know." Kitagawa's expression was grim as he cast one last, reluctant look around.

The room was small, with nowhere to hide. Everything inside could be taken in at a glance—and yet, somehow, a grown man had vanished.

Time was running out; he couldn't search any longer.

The plan had been to use the explosion to lure the target out, or at least scare him into showing himself. But the bastard had kept calm, staying put.

Forced to act, Kitagawa had kicked the door in—but now he worried the man might have used the opportunity to set up an ambush.

What he hadn't expected was for the target to pull off a full-blown disappearing act.

Not wasting another second, Kitagawa strode to the operating table, hefted the unconscious blonde onto his shoulder like cargo, adjusted the backpack on his back, and headed out of the room at a brisk pace.

Some time after he left, a "doll" in the corner of the room suddenly unfolded—like a flower blooming from the inside out.

From within stepped a middle-aged man with gray-white hair.

Goodwin.

He stood there silently, his face as dark as storm clouds, staring at the doorway without a word.

Carrying the blonde, Kitagawa walked boldly out through the front door of the apartment.

The so-called "basic protective measure" of the residence—what Sasha had called its first line of defense—was now nothing more than a doorway blown apart by explosives.

In any era, brute-force physical methods were always reliable.

Reaching the elevator lobby, Kitagawa spotted David, who had been waiting nervously for some time. The kid's eyes darted around, tense and on edge, as if expecting enemies to burst in at any moment.

He was hammering the elevator button to keep it on their floor, and only relaxed when Kitagawa finally appeared.

"What's the plan? Where are we running to?" David asked anxiously.

He'd been muted from speaking on the comms earlier, unable to join the conversation between Kitagawa and Sasha, but she hadn't completely booted him from the channel—so he'd still heard everything.

Bored out of his mind in the suite, David had been urged by Sasha to come help in a simple but critical way—

—hold the elevator at the top floor.

He'd taken the job without hesitation, keeping the elevator here for several minutes, all the while nervously waiting for Hiroshi.

"Fourth floor—the suite Lin-kun rented. We're jumping out the window from there," Kitagawa said without pause, stepping into the elevator.

David followed, tense. Seeing Kitagawa press the button for the third floor instead, he blurted out, "Wait, that's the third floor… That's still pretty high. Can we really jump from there?"

"You think Lin-kun rented that place just so we'd have entry access to this building?" Kitagawa smirked.

"He even planned our escape route?" David's eyes went wide.

"Of course," Kitagawa replied with a cold smile, as if disappointed by David's lack of vision.

As the elevator descended to the third floor, Sasha chimed in: there was already a security team posted at the building's front entrance, lightly armed for now—but if they got stalled, reinforcements would be on the way.

So there was no point debating escape routes. Alone, Kitagawa could probably punch through. But with an unconscious woman over one shoulder and a rookie tagging along, the risk wasn't worth it.

The elevator doors opened. They encountered no resistance along the way—saving them a few bullets.

At their suite, Kitagawa went straight to the window, scanning outside.

The third floor wasn't too high. With his cyberware and skills, he could land unharmed. There were no AC units or metal grilles to get in the way.

"I'll go first. David, you toss her down to me after. I'll catch her, then you jump," Kitagawa ordered.

"Got it."

Setting the blonde aside, Kitagawa vaulted out effortlessly, landing with ease. He reached up with his cybernetic arm to catch the woman as David dropped her down.

Then, as David swung one leg over the sill to jump himself, he glanced down—and froze.

Kitagawa, carrying the woman, was already sprinting away at full tilt, more than ten meters down the street.

"Whoa—wait for me!"
